Quantum computing: what is it?
Over the past few years, quantum computing has gained popularity, with artificial intelligence emerging as one of its main application areas.
The application of quantum computing, a novel technology that processes data using the concepts of quantum physics, may significantly improve the efficiency and speed of machine learning.
Quantum physics is the basis of Quantum Computing and is very different from classical physics. Information can be represented by particles such as electrons and photons, which in quantum physics are able to exist in several states simultaneously.
This suggests that quantum computers are capable of processing massive amounts of data far faster than traditional computers, and they can also solve complex issues that traditional computers find difficult to solve.
In the field of machine learning, quantum computing can be used to expedite the execution of complex calculations and simulations.
A quantum computer, for example, may be used to quickly analyze large data sets and identify patterns that would be difficult to find using traditional computing methods.
By using quantum computing, machine learning systems can operate more efficiently. By using a quantum computer to evaluate data and find the most efficient ways to perform various tasks, even AI systems may be made far more productive and efficient.
This type of optimization has the potential to greatly increase AI systems' productivity while reducing maintenance costs.
What makes quantum computers necessary?
Quantum computing is a rapidly developing field that could fundamentally change how we tackle challenging computer problems.
With the aid of quantum physics, this technology is able to perform calculations that are far more intricate than those that can be completed on a traditional computer.
This blog will go over the need for quantum computers and how they could be used to solve problems that traditional computers can't.
Resolving Complicated Issues
One of the main reasons we need quantum computers is their ability to solve problems that are outside the purview of traditional computers.
Complex optimization problems and those needing massive amounts of processing power, such simulating intricate chemical reactions or modeling protein folding, can be solved by quantum computing.
Encryption
Cryptography plays a major role in modern communication networks, such as the internet and secure financial transactions.
As of right now, data encrypted with techniques used by conventional computers is decrypted by a quantum computer.
Because of this, we need to develop new encryption methods that are resistant to quantum attacks, and quantum computing provides the means to do it.
Robotic Learning
Machine learning is a rapidly developing field that could fundamentally alter our way of life and employment.
Quantum computers are capable of much faster machine learning tasks than conventional computers.
This is because massive volumes of data can be handled concurrently by quantum computers, in contrast to traditional computers that can only process one bit at a time.
Analysis of Big Data
Our lives are being impacted by huge data, and quantum computing can bring us new and profound insights into the analysis and understanding of this data.
For example, quantum computers may do complex data processing tasks like pattern recognition and clustering that are now beyond the capabilities of ordinary computers.
The field of quantum computing has a bright future ahead of it, with more advancements and innovations to come.
Quantum Computer Types
Quantum computing, a relatively new technology, has the power to fundamentally change how computations are done.
Comparing quantum computers to conventional computers, which store and process data using binary digits (bits) that can only be either 0 or 1, quantum bits (qubits) can exist in several states simultaneously.
Because of this, certain types of computations can be performed by quantum computers significantly more swiftly and efficiently than by conventional computers.
These are a few of the most common varieties:
High-Performance Quantum Computers
This type of quantum computer uses superconducting circuits to control and modify the quantum states of qubits.
Superconducting quantum computers are among the most advanced available today, and they are used for many different applications, including cryptography, modeling, and optimization.
Trap Ion Quantum Computing
Ions, or charged atoms, are used as qubits in this kind of quantum computing. A trap holds ions in place.
Ion trap quantum computers have the exceptional stability and dependability needed to run quantum algorithms and simulations.
Quantum Computers with Topological Properties
Topological state-based qubits, which are immune to errors caused by external factors like temperature or electromagnetic radiation, are used in this type of quantum computer.
Topological quantum computers are currently in their early stages of development, but in the long run, they have the potential to be incredibly reliable and scalable.
Quantum Computers with Optics
The qubits utilized in this type of quantum computer are photons. Optical quantum computers are highly scalable devices with a wide range of applications, including quantum simulations and quantum algorithms.
Quantum Adiabatic Computers
This particular type of quantum computer is based on the idea of adiabatic evolution, which means converting a system gradually from a start point to an end point.
Adiabatic quantum computers are still in their early stages of development, but they have a lot of potential uses.
Our lives are being impacted by huge data, and quantum computing can bring us new and profound insights into the analysis and understanding of this data.
For example, quantum computers may do complex data processing tasks like pattern recognition and clustering that are now beyond the capabilities of ordinary computers.
The field of quantum computing has a bright future ahead of it, with more advancements and innovations to come.
Features of Quantum Computing
Secure communication is also anticipated to enter a new era with the advent of quantum computing. In the era of quantum computing, the traditional methods of computer encryption are no longer secure. As a result, it also possesses the following attributes:
- Superposition: Multiple states of existence can be simultaneously maintained by quantum computers.
- Particles that are entangled are connected to one another regardless of their distance from one another.
- The ability to process several instructions at once is known as quantum parallelism.
- Quantum Interference: Particles can interact with one another through interference between their quantum states.
- Quantum Error Correction: Quantum computing is more reliable and accurate when error-correction codes are used.
- Quantum simulations are computer programs that simulate physical processes using quantum computing.
Advantages of Quantum Computing
The field of computing could undergo a complete transformation thanks to a novel and ground-breaking technology called quantum computing.
Instead of using conventional binary bits, the technology makes use of quantum bits, or qubits, which are based on the ideas of quantum mechanics.
Compared to conventional computing techniques, this new computing approach has the following advantages:
- Faster processing: The simultaneous execution of numerous calculations is made possible by quantum computers' use of quantum parallelism.
- Processing massive volumes of data considerably more quickly than with regular computing is conceivable even with the aid of quantum computing.
- Improved problem solving: Quantum computers have the capacity to simultaneously investigate every potential solution to a problem. This allows for the fastest feasible solution to be found in a smaller amount of time.
- High-Level Security: Because quantum computers employ nearly impenetrable quantum encryption, they are perfect for sensitive applications like government communications and banking transactions.
- Enhanced accuracy: Complex problem solving is made more accurate by the ability of quantum computing algorithms to function in quantum superpositions.
- Better machine learning: Compared to conventional computing techniques, quantum computing allows for faster and more accurate training of machine learning models.
Applications of Quantum Computing
Quantum computing applications offer previously unheard-of levels of precision and efficacy, and they are being investigated in a wide range of industries, including finance and healthcare. In the next section, we'll go over each of the applications of quantum computing one by one:
Drug development and discovery
By modeling and analyzing chemical interactions with quantum computing, drug development and prediction accuracy can be increased.
Mapping finances
Because it may be used to solve complex financial challenges like pricing derivatives and forecasting market risk, quantum computing is a helpful tool for financial institutions.
Predicting the weather
Quantum computing can process large amounts of weather data, which will enhance weather forecasting and preparedness for disasters.
Control of traffic
Quantum computing can be used to simulate and analyze traffic patterns, improving traffic management and reducing congestion.
Simulated environment
Quantum computing can be used to model complex environmental systems, improving forecasts and aiding in the resolution of environmental issues.